MySQL事务处理与无障碍控制设计深度解析
发布时间:2026-03-30 08:34:28 所属栏目:MySql教程 来源:DaWei
导读: MySQL事务处理是数据库管理系统中确保数据一致性和完整性的关键机制。通过将多个操作组合成一个逻辑单元,事务能够保证所有操作要么全部成功,要么全部失败回滚,从而避免部分更新导致的数据不一致问题。 在
|
MySQL事务处理是数据库管理系统中确保数据一致性和完整性的关键机制。通过将多个操作组合成一个逻辑单元,事务能够保证所有操作要么全部成功,要么全部失败回滚,从而避免部分更新导致的数据不一致问题。 在MySQL中,事务的实现依赖于存储引擎的支持,例如InnoDB。它提供了ACID特性,即原子性、一致性、隔离性和持久性。这些特性确保了即使在系统故障或并发操作中,数据仍然保持正确状态。
本结构图由AI绘制,仅供参考 无障碍控制设计则关注如何让不同用户或应用在访问数据库时,既能高效操作,又不会相互干扰。这通常通过锁机制、事务隔离级别和乐观并发控制等技术实现。合理设置隔离级别可以减少锁竞争,提高系统吞吐量。在实际应用中,开发人员需要根据业务需求选择合适的事务边界和隔离级别。例如,在高并发场景下,使用较低的隔离级别如“读已提交”可以提升性能,但需注意可能引发的脏读或不可重复读问题。 事务的管理还涉及回滚日志和重做日志的维护,这些机制保障了事务的持久性和崩溃恢复能力。良好的事务设计不仅能提升系统稳定性,还能优化整体性能表现。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
推荐文章
站长推荐

